Great For Storing Leather
I have some leather clothing. The problem is that over time while stored, if not careful, any moisture in the air can bring light dusty mold or mildew. These packets come in handy.WHAT ARE THESE LIKE?There bags come in an air proof resealable bag. You cut the top off, and there is a zip closure to keep it shut. The packets (3 of them) come in approx 3 inch squares.WHAT DO I USE THEM FOR?After cleaning off my leather, I put the leather in a plastic zipper bag and include the packets to keep them while in storage until they are ready to wear.DO THEY WORK?Yes, these work well. I use them often in this case and these are the type I use.HOW TO RECHARGE?To recharge these, put in the oven at 275F and heat on a tray for about 2 or 3 hours depending on how damp they are. Once cool, put them in an airtight container until ready to use.THE BOTTOM LINEThese silica packets are great for packing leather or other items that you need to protect from moisture. They can be recharged.MY RATINGFIVE STARS. Works as expected
The SiliPacks silica gel packets seem to do what they are supposed to do and are larger than I expected. My husband brews beer, and he keeps one taped to the lid of his grain bins and switches it after each brew day to help keep the grains fresh. He also keeps another pack in the hops that are stored in the freezer.
